> > > > > kernel kernel size time in
> > > > > decompress_kernel
> > > > > compressed (gzip) 3.3M 53ms
> > > > > uncompressed 14M 3ms
> > > >
> > Exactly, LZ4 is the fastest. It takes 16ms to complete the
> > decompression. Still sounds a little longer when compared to
> > uncompressed kernel.
>
> Are we seriously talking here about one-time improvement of 13ms
> boot time?
The usage model for us is to lunch kernel in virtual machine and there
will be thousands of instances lunched and shutdowned/re-lunched
frequently, so every single million-second helps. And 13ms means 20%
improvement to our existing optimization (the other part besides
decompression is optimized to ~40ms).
